Etova in english

Translation: etova, Dictionary: finnish » english

Source language:
finnish
Target language:
english
Translations:
sickening, revolting, repugnant
Etova in english
Related words

Translations

  • etninen in english - ethnic, ethnical, race, of ethnic
  • etnologia in english - ethnography, ethnology
  • etsaus in english - etching, the etching, etched, for etching, of etching
  • etsijä in english - searcher, seeker, hunter, a seeker, seeker of
Random words
Etova in english - Dictionary: finnish » english
Translations: sickening, revolting, repugnant